huokosnesteitä
Huokosnesteitä refers to fluids that occupy the pore spaces within solid materials. These fluids can be liquids or gases, and their presence significantly influences the physical and chemical properties of the host material. In geology, pore fluids are crucial for understanding processes like groundwater flow, hydrocarbon migration, and the weathering of rocks. The composition of pore fluids can vary widely, from fresh water to saline brines, or even trapped gases like methane.
